Break-Glass Access — Gallerine Audio-Guide App

For the weekly sync: reminder of how break-glass works on Gallerine. If the exhibit content pipeline is down and the on-call admin is unreachable, any senior engineer may invoke break-glass to push emergency audio updates directly to the museum kiosks. Every invocation is logged and reviewed at the next sync. The break-glass console requires two things: your staff credential and the shared recovery passphrase. For reference during an incident, the current passphrase is the line below.

unlock words, hahip-baduf: holwyn-istath-julvan

Handover note — Crumbwheel order cutoffs.

Welcome aboard. The bakery cutoff rule in Crumbwheel closes same-day orders at 14:00 local to each storefront, not UTC — this has bitten us twice. Holiday overrides live in the calendar service and take precedence silently, so always check there first when a cutoff looks wrong. To unlock the calendar service's admin console after a restart, enter the recovery passphrase below.

vault phrase of bagap-bahaf = silion-pelox-sorox-casdor-quenwyn-fraax-eliox-praael-kelion-quenvan-kasox-rusael-norius-belvan

// Timezone handling for Ledgerline report exports: all timestamps are
// stored in UTC and converted at render time using the tenant's saved
// zone, never the server locale. Do not "fix" apparent off-by-one-day
// rows here; they are DST edges handled downstream.
// The export client authenticates to the internal scheduler with the key below.

app token of yajeg-kawef = kto11_7En3XSX8xQw